How to Deconstruct the Offer Before You Click
Step 1: Identify the exact wagering multiplier. If the fine print reads “35x”, multiply the bonus amount (£5) by 35, giving you £175 of forced play. That’s the real price tag.
Step 2: Compare the required turnover to your average weekly stake. A habitual £20 weekly bettor will need 8.75 weeks of regular play just to clear the bonus – assuming they never lose the entire bankroll in the meantime.
Step 3: Factor in volatility. A high‑variance slot like Dead or Alive can produce £10 wins in a single spin, but also wipe out a £20 bankroll in three spins. The higher the volatility, the more unpredictable the route to meeting the turnover.
Step 4: Scrutinise the withdrawal caps. Many 2026 promotions cap cash‑out at £10, meaning even if you magically convert the bonus into £30 profit, you’ll only walk away with a fraction of that.
